Identifying Sprinkler Issues



Identifying sprinkler concerns is an important initial step in efficient lawn sprinkler repair work. Appropriate identification of problems ensures that the best solutions are applied, reducing downtime and avoiding further damages. Typical sprinkler issues include low tide stress, unequal water distribution, non-rotating sprinkler heads, and noticeable wear or damage to components.


Begin by visually checking out the sprinkler heads for any kind of indications of physical damage or clog. Next, observe the sprinkler system throughout its operation.


In addition, evaluate the control shutoffs and timer settings to ensure they are working correctly. Malfunctions in these elements can bring about over-watering or under-watering specific locations. Finally, check the area bordering the lawn sprinkler for signs of water merging or unusually dry spots, which might suggest leaks or bad coverage.


Fixing Leaks





Dealing with leaks in an automatic sprinkler is vital to maintaining its efficiency and preventing water waste. Leaks can occur due to different factors, such as damaged seals, busted pipelines, or defective links. Identifying the source of the leak is the very first step. Evaluate the entire system, concentrating on sprinkler heads, valves, and pipelines. Try to find pooling water or unusually wet areas in the lawn as indicators.


As soon as the leak resource is determined, turn off the water to the automatic sprinkler. For leaks at the lawn sprinkler head, unscrew the head and examine the seal. Change worn or harmed seals with new ones. If the leakage is due to a fractured pipeline, use a PVC cutter to get rid of the damaged area and replace it with a brand-new piece, safeguarding it with PVC concrete and combinings.

For leaks at shutoff connections, tighten the installations or replace faulty components as needed. Always make certain that all fixings are leak-proof before turning the water back on. Routine upkeep and prompt fixings can substantially prolong the life expectancy of your sprinkler system and add to water conservation initiatives.


Changing Spray Patterns

When maximizing an automatic sprinkler, readjusting spray patterns is vital to make certain also water circulation and avoid waste. Properly adjusted spray patterns ensure that all locations of the landscape receive sufficient moisture without oversaturating certain areas or leaving others completely dry.


To adjust the spray pattern, initial determine the type of lawn sprinkler head in use, as various models have differed change systems. For rotor-type lawn sprinklers, modifications generally entail a crucial or a specialized tool to change the arc and span.


Following, observe the sprinkler in procedure. Guarantee that the spray gets to the desired insurance coverage area without overlapping exceedingly onto sidewalks, driveways, or buildings. Fine-tuning might be required to attain optimal insurance coverage, which can be done by slightly tweaking the modification screw or trick.


On a regular basis checking and readjusting spray patterns is necessary, particularly after seasonal modifications or upkeep activities. Constant changes contribute to water conservation and advertise the health and aesthetic appeals of the landscape, ensuring the automatic sprinkler runs successfully.

Changing Faulty Heads



Changing spray patterns makes certain that your lawn sprinkler runs effectively, yet often issues develop that can not be fixed via basic adjustments. One common trouble is a defective lawn sprinkler head, which can lead to irregular water distribution or full failure of particular zones - Sprinkler shut off replacement. To preserve ideal efficiency, replacing these malfunctioning heads is important


Begin by determining the malfunctioning head. Look for indications such as irregular spray patterns, water pooling, or heads that do not withdraw appropriately. As soon as determined, transform off the water supply to the automatic sprinkler to stay clear of any unexpected activation throughout the substitute process.


Next, dig deep into the location around the sprinkler head, ensuring you do not damage the bordering piping. Carefully unscrew the faulty head from the riser, bearing in mind of the kind and specifications for precise substitute (Sprinkler shut off replacement). Mount the new head by screwing it onto the riser, ensuring it is safely attached


After installment, turn the water back on and evaluate the brand-new head. Readjust the spray pattern as required to ensure proper protection. Routine examination and timely replacement More hints of malfunctioning heads can considerably enhance the performance and durability of your automatic sprinkler, ensuring your landscape continues to be lavish and healthy.


Winterizing Your Lawn Sprinkler



Appropriate winterization of your lawn sprinkler system is essential to avoid pricey damages and guarantee its preparedness for the following expanding period. When temperatures drop, any type of water left in the pipes can freeze, expand, and potentially create splits or ruptured pipelines. To prevent such problems, view it begin by shutting off the supply of water to the irrigation system. Next, drain pipes the system to get rid of recurring water from pipes, valves, and sprinkler heads. This can be done using the hand-operated drainpipe valve method, the automated drainpipe valve method, or by utilizing an air compressor to burn out the system.


Using an air compressor is frequently taken into consideration one of the most efficient method. Attach the compressor to the irrigation system, establishing the stress to no greater than 50 PSI for PVC pipelines or 80 PSI for versatile polyethylene pipelines. Sequentially turn on each zone to ensure that all water is removed.


In addition, protect any above-ground elements such as backflow preventers and shutoffs. Use insulation tape or foam covers to safeguard these parts from best hose sprinkler freezing temperatures. Proper winterization not just safeguards the integrity of your lawn sprinkler system but likewise extends its life expectancy, guaranteeing reliable operation come springtime.
